Responsibilities

  • Perform daily, periodic, annual, and biennial locomotive inspections in accordance with FRA 49 CFR Part 229 Subpart B.
  • Conduct preventive maintenance, servicing, and functional testing of diesel locomotives.
  • Diagnose and troubleshoot mechanical, electrical, hydraulic, and pneumatic system failures.
  • Repair or replace major locomotive components, including diesel engines, power assemblies, air brake systems, traction motors, generators, trucks, wheels, and axles.
  • Perform air brake testing and calibration in compliance with FRA requirements.
  • Inspect locomotives for oil, fuel, air, and coolant leaks, as well as structural defects.
  • Maintain compliance with FRA safety standards for brake systems, electrical systems, and mechanical components.
  • Ensure defective locomotives are repaired prior to service or handled according to FRA non-compliance procedures.
  • Complete and maintain required inspection reports and maintenance records, including defect documentation and corrective actions.
  • Maintain inspection and maintenance documentation in accordance with required retention periods.
  • Ensure all work complies with 49 CFR Part 229 and Part 230 locomotive safety and maintenance standards.
  • Support FRA audits, inspections, and regulatory compliance reviews.
  • Assist with railroad track inspections in accordance with 49 CFR Part 213 Track Safety Standards.
  • Identify and document rail defects, track geometry issues, and deficiencies involving ties, ballast, and fasteners.
  • Perform or assist with minor track maintenance and repairs, including rail fastening, joint tightening, tie replacement, and ballast stabilization.
  • Support Continuous Welded Rail (CWR) inspection and maintenance compliance requirements.
  • Assist with corrective actions for unsafe track conditions requiring remedial action.
  • Operate cranes, forklifts, jacks, hoists, rail maintenance tools, and diagnostic equipment.
  • Support locomotive movement, switching operations, and service preparation activities.
  • Perform field repairs and respond to emergency maintenance situations as required.
  • Adhere to FRA safety regulations, OSHA requirements, and railroad operating rules such as GCOR.
  • Maintain compliance with On-Track Worker Safety procedures and requirements.
  • Identify unsafe conditions and implement corrective safety measures.
